I received a alert with a siren saying a virus was on my computer.  I clicked delete, then I scanned my computer.  It showed no virus detected. After the scan was finished it showed me a page with 66 lines all saying unable to scan.  There was at tab for action for me to take but I never understood what to do.  They all seemed to have something to do with  java.  Please, can anyone tell me what I should have done with them, I was afraid to delete and now I am wondering what I should have done.

After the scan was finished it showed me a page with 66 lines all saying unable to scan.
That is normal behaviour. Those files are encrypted or passwrod protected. Avast (and for that matter any other av) can not scan encrypted or pw protected files if it doesn't know the encryption method or pw. From your post I understand that they all are in the java folder. If they are in the java cache folder, just delete them. If they are not in the cache folder, just let them be.
